    Here's a good illustration of the phenomenon of reticular activation.
    Think about something like blue cars, or a particular make and model
    of a car. Try to think about it for 30 minutes. Not as easy as you
    think! But if you do that, and keep it in your consciousness, you'll
    notice blue cars or whatever make and model car during your day.

    They'll "stand out" more than other cars. I've tried that and it really
    worked. I noticed the thing I thought about in my day than anything
    else.
